Here’s the latest high-level update on the Chicago Bears stadium situation based on recent coverage:
- Location focus shifting among Arlington Heights, Illinois, and Indiana (Gary) amid funding and legislative debates. Illinois lawmakers are weighing incentives and public funding for a new stadium, while Indiana has actively courted the team with potential stadium authority and financing options.[1][2]
- Arlington Heights remains a central option, with ongoing development talks and a push to finalize an economically transformative project for the region, though progress hinges on legislative approvals and financial commitments.[2]
- Public funding and tax incentive details continue to be a sticking point, with multiple updates indicating lawmakers seeking firm commitments from the Bears before finalizing deals.[7][9]
- Recent media coverage suggests continued scrutiny of cost, funding, and location viability, with some outlets noting fluctuating momentum and competing proposals as of early 2026.[4][9][10]
